Story Idea: Georgia Education

I know there has been a lot of reporting done on education lately (and that my previous story idea was about education as well), but this issue really concerns me as I have a younger brother still in high school.

As many may know, a large amount of students failed the CRCT tests this year (some as low as 10 points), forcing them to attend summer school in order to continue onto the next grade level.

While it’s normal for a few students to fail the test each year, summer school should not be as crowded as on a regular school day.  When that many students are failing, it’s not a problem with the students, I think, but a problem with the test or policy.  A lot of teachers and students have said that the CRCT tests were changed this year, which caused teachers not to fully prepare their students and take some students by surprise.

Not only would I like to compare the test scores from this year and perhaps a couple of years ago, but if possible, I would like to examine Georgia’s ranking in education compared to other states in the country who do no test their students with something like the CRCT.  In addition, I’d like to see what changes were made to the CRCT this year and find out why those changes were made.  Furthermore, I want to know what the State Department of Education thinks of this new development and what they plan to do to try and fix it.  Finally, I’d like to be able to interview a couple of teachers (from different counties if it’s possible) and students to view their opinions about these tests.
